Anteprima
Vedrai una selezione di 7 pagine su 30
Fondamenti d'Informatica 2 - progetto Basi di Dati con SQL:  Agenzia Immobiliare Pag. 1 Fondamenti d'Informatica 2 - progetto Basi di Dati con SQL:  Agenzia Immobiliare Pag. 2
Anteprima di 7 pagg. su 30.
Scarica il documento per vederlo tutto.
Fondamenti d'Informatica 2 - progetto Basi di Dati con SQL:  Agenzia Immobiliare Pag. 6
Anteprima di 7 pagg. su 30.
Scarica il documento per vederlo tutto.
Fondamenti d'Informatica 2 - progetto Basi di Dati con SQL:  Agenzia Immobiliare Pag. 11
Anteprima di 7 pagg. su 30.
Scarica il documento per vederlo tutto.
Fondamenti d'Informatica 2 - progetto Basi di Dati con SQL:  Agenzia Immobiliare Pag. 16
Anteprima di 7 pagg. su 30.
Scarica il documento per vederlo tutto.
Fondamenti d'Informatica 2 - progetto Basi di Dati con SQL:  Agenzia Immobiliare Pag. 21
Anteprima di 7 pagg. su 30.
Scarica il documento per vederlo tutto.
Fondamenti d'Informatica 2 - progetto Basi di Dati con SQL:  Agenzia Immobiliare Pag. 26
1 su 30
D/illustrazione/soddisfatti o rimborsati
Disdici quando
vuoi
Acquista con carta
o PayPal
Scarica i documenti
tutte le volte che vuoi
Estratto del documento

ELENCO  ENTITA’  

ENTITA’   DESCRIZIONE   ATTRIBUTI   IDENTIFICATORE  

  Contiene  informazioni  riguardanti   Città   CodAgenzia  

Agenzia   le  agenzie  che  gestiscono  gli     Via  

appartamenti  da  affittare  e  già     N.Civico  

affittati.  In  ogni  provincia  italiana  è  presente  un’Agenzia.   CodAgenzia  

NumTelefono  

Nome  

  Contiene  informazioni  riguardanti   CodAppartamento   CodAppartamento  

Appartamento   gli  appartamenti  gestiti  dalle  agenzie.     NumInquilini  

Città  

Via  

N.Civico  

Capienza  

  Contiene  informazioni  relative  al   Nome   CodFiscale    

  proprietario  di  uno  o  più  appartamenti.   Cognome    

Proprietario   Via  

Città  

N.Civico  

NumTelefono  

Data  nascita  

CodFiscale  

Zone  Condominiali   Contiene  informazioni  relative  alle  zone   CodZona   CodZona  

Condominiali  in  condivisione  tra  appartamenti.   TipoZona  

Stanza  Condivisa   Contiene  informazioni  relative  alle     TipoStanza   CodStanza  

stanze  condivise  dagli  Inquilini.  Una  StanzaCondivisa  è  in   CodStanza  

condivisione  tra  tutti  gli  Inquilini  che  abitano  nell’appartamento.  

  Camera   Contiene  informazioni  relative  alle  camere  da  letto.   CodCamera   CodCamera  

  Mq  

  4  

N.Finestre    

  Contiene  informazioni  relative  ai  mobili  e     Nome   CodProdotto  

  oggetti  presenti  nelle  camere  da  letto.   Colore    

Arredo   Tipo    

Anno    

CodProdotto  

  Contiene  informazioni  relative  agli  Inquilini  che  abitano  negli   No        Nome   CodFiscale    

  Appartamenti.   Cognome  

  CodFiscale    

Inquilino   Data  nascita    

Luogo  nascita  

NumTelefono    

Sesso  

  Contiene  informazioni  relative  alle  pulizie   Data  prevista   CodPulizia    

Pulizia   da  effettuare.  La  Pulizia  di  una  StanzaCondivisa  sarà  effettuata  da   CodPulizia  

tutti  gli  inquilini  che  la  condividono.  La  Pulizia  di  una  camera  sarà    

effettuata  dal  solo  Inquilino  che  la  abita.  

Pagamento  Effettuato   Contiene  informazioni  relative  ai  pagamenti  effettuati  da  parte   DataPagamento   CodPagamento    

degli  inquilini.  Ogni  Pagamento  prevede  già  la  quota  mensile  di   CodPagamento  

affitto  e  le  bollette  da  pagare  divise  per  Inquilino.    Ogni   Importo    

Pagamento  ha  come  destinatario    il  Proprietario   Destinatario  

dell’appartamento.    

Pagamento  da   Contiene  informazioni  relative  ai  pagamenti  da  effettuare  da   DataScadenza   CodPagamento  

Effettuare   parte  degli  inquilini.    Ogni  Pagamento  prevede  già  la  quota   CodPagamento    

mensile  di  affitto  e  le  bollette  da  pagare  divise  per  Inquilino.  Ogni   Importo  

Pagamento  ha  come  destinatario    il  Proprietario   Destinatario    

dell’appartamento.  

Alimento   Contiene  informazioni  relative  agli  alimenti  appartenenti  agli   Scadenza   CodEsemplare    

Inquilini.   CodEsemplare  

NomeEsemplare    

Detersivo   Contiene  informazioni  relative  ai  Detersivi  appartenenti  agli   Tipo   CodEsemplare  

Inquilini.   CodEsemplare    

NomeEsemplare  

 

  5  

ELENCO  RELAZIONI  

 

 

RELAZIONE   ENTITA’  COINVOLTE   DESCRIZIONE   ATTRIBUTI  

Gestione   Agenzia(1,n)   Associa  l’appartamento    

Appartamento(1,1)   all’agenzia  che  ne  gestisce  l’affitto.  

Appartenenza   Proprietario(1,n)   Associa  l’appartamento  con  il  rispettivo    

Appartamento(1,1)   proprietario.   DataAcquisto  

Condivisione   Appartamento(1,n)   Associa  l’appartamento  con  le  zone    

Zone  condominiali(1,n)   condominiali  da  esso  condivise.  

Composizione   Appartamento(1,n)   Associa  appartamento  con  le  proprie    

Camera(1,1)   camere  da  letto.  

ComposizioneStanze   Appartamento(1,n)   Associa  Appartamento  con  le  proprie  stanze    

StanzaCondivisa(1,1)   condivise  tra  gli  Inquilini  

Affitto   Camera(0,1)   Associa  l’inquilino  con  la  camera  da  letto  da   Durata  

Inquilino(0,1)   lui  affittata.   DataContratto  

Affitto  Scaduto   Camera(0,n)   Associa  all’Inquilino  le  camere  da  letto  da   DataContratto  

Inquilino  (0,n)   lui  affittate  in  passato.   DataScadenzaContratto  

Arredamento   Camera(1,1)   Associa  la  camera  con  il  rispettivo   Quantità  

Arredo(0,n)   arredamento  presente  al  suo  interno.  

Eseguire   StanzaCondivisa(0,n)   Associa  StanzaCondivisa  con  le  pulizie  in    

Pulizia  (1,1)   essa  effettuate   DataReale  

Pulire   Camera(0,n)   Associa  la  Camera  con  le  pulizie  in  essa   DataReale  

Pulizia(1,1)   effettuate  

PossessoAlimento   Alimento(1,1)   Associa  l’Inquilino  con  l’alimenti  di  sua    

Inquilino(0,n)   proprietà.  

PossessoDetersivo   Detersivo(1,1)   Associa  l’Inquilino  con  i  detersivi  di  sua    

Inquilino(0,n)   proprietà  

  6  

Effettuazione   Pagamento  effettuato1,n)   Associa  l’inquilino  con  i  pagamenti  che  deve    

Inquilino(1,1)   effettuare  o  che  ha  già  effettuato.   Importo  

EffettuazioneFutura   Pagamento  da  effettuare(0,1)   Associa  all’entità  figlio  Alimento  della    

Inquilino(1,1)   generalizzazione,  l’entità  padre  Oggetto  

 

OPERAZIONI  

  DESCRIZIONE   FREQUENZA  

1)  Inserire  un  nuovo  Inquilino  (Coinvolge  ridondanza).   1  volta  al  giorno  

2)  Inserire  un  nuovo  Proprietario  con  nuovo  appartamento  (Coinvolge   1  volta  al  giorno  

ridondanza).  

3)  Trovare  il  numero  di  Inquilini  che  abitano  in  un  appartamento  dato  il  codice   50  volte  al  giorno  

di  una  Pulizia  effettuata  in  una  StanzaCondivisa  (Coinvolge  ridondanza).  

4)  Trovare  Nome  e  Cognome  dell’Inquilino  che  abita  in  una  certa  camera  dato   100  volte  al  giorno  

il  Codice  Camera.  

5)  Dato  un  CodCamera,  trovare  l’ultima  pulizia  che  è  stata  effettuata  e  da  chi.   1  volta  al  giorno  

6)  Dato  un  CodPagamento,  trovare  quale  Inquilino  lo  ha  effettuato  e  chi  è  il   300  volte  al  giorno  

Destinatario.  (Coinvolge  ridondanza)  

7)  Dato  un  Proprietario,  trovare  il  CodApp  degli  appartamenti  che  possiede.   50  volte  al  giorno  

8)  Trova

Dettagli
Publisher
A.A. 2013-2014
30 pagine
SSD Scienze matematiche e informatiche INF/01 Informatica

I contenuti di questa pagina costituiscono rielaborazioni personali del Publisher wrong di informazioni apprese con la frequenza delle lezioni di Fondamenti di Informatica 2 e studio autonomo di eventuali libri di riferimento in preparazione dell'esame finale o della tesi. Non devono intendersi come materiale ufficiale dell'università Università degli Studi di Pisa o del prof De Francesco Nicoletta.